Definition(s) for: 五常

Hanzi Pinyin Definition(s)
五常 wǔ cháng - Wuchang, county-level city in Harbin 哈爾濱|哈尔滨[Ha1 er3 bin1], Heilongjiang
- the Permanent Five (the five permanent members of the United Nations Security Council: China, France, Russia, the UK, and the USA)
五常 wǔ cháng - the five cardinal virtues in traditional Chinese ethics: benevolence 仁[ren2], justice 義|义[yi4], propriety 禮|礼[li3], wisdom 智[zhi4] and honor 信[xin4]
- alternative term for 五倫|五伦[wu3lun2], the five cardinal relationships
- alternative term for 五行[wu3xing2], the five elements
